基于测井资料的古地貌-不整合识别及控藏特征研究——以鄂尔多斯盆地三边地区中生界为例

摘要 鄂尔多斯盆地三边地区三叠系顶不整合对下部延长组和上部延安组的油气成藏有着重要的影响,为了查明该不整合的发育规模、与古地貌的关系及对成藏的贡献,利用测井方法进行了古地貌恢复和不整合结构定量划分,并分析了不同古地貌单元不整合结构及其控藏特征.结果表明:(1)三叠系古地貌分为河谷、河间丘、坡嘴、斜坡带和高地共5个单元,风化黏土层主要在坡嘴和斜坡发育,风化淋滤带主要在河谷和高地发育,其次是斜坡和坡嘴;(2)建立了不整合结构测井定量划分的标准,风化黏土层:PC_(1)≥250,PC_(2)≤90,风化淋滤带:PC_(1)≤250,PC_(2)≤90或PC_(1)≥250,PC_(2)≥90;未风化原岩:PC_(1)≤250,PC_(2)≥90;(3)三叠系顶不整合作为“中转站”,与上部延9-延10段、下部长21-长23未风化岩石层之间形成具有“竞争”关系的3个含油气层,油气分布呈“互补”特征. The top unconformity of the Triassic in the Sanbian area of the Ordos Basin has an important influence on the hydrocarbon accumulation of the lower Yanchang Formation and the upper Yan'an Formation.In order to find out the development scale of the unconformity,its relationship with paleogeomorphology and its contribution to the hydrocarbon accumulation,the paleogeomorphic restoration and unconformity structure are quantitatively divided by logging method,and the unconformity structure and reservoir-controlling characteristics of different paleogeomorphic units are analyzed.The results show that:(1)The paleogeomorphology of the Triassic is divided into five units:valley,inter-river hill,slope mouths,slope and highland.The weathered clay layer mainly develops in the slope mouths and slope,and the weathered leach zone mainly develops in the valley and highland,followed by slope and slope mouths;(2)The quantitative classification criteria of unconformity logging are established.The weathering clay layer is PC_(1)≥250,PC_(2)≤90,and the weathering leaching zone is PC_(1)≤250,PC_(2)≤90 or PC_(1)≥250,PC_(2)≥90.Unweathered protolith:PC_(1)≤250,PC_(2)≥90;(3)As a“transfer station”,the top unconformity of the Triassic system forms three OB(oil and gas-braring bed)with a“competitive”relationship with the upper Yan 9-Yan 10 member and the lower Chang 21-Chang 23 unweathered rock layer,and the oil and gas distribution is“complementary”.
